According to the ________, a defendant will be held criminally liable for a death if the other elements of criminal homicide are met, and if without the defendant's conduct the victim would not have died at that point in time

A: substantial factor testB: "but for" testC: absolute ruleD: felony murder rule

Answer:

(B) "but for" test

Step-by-step explanation:

The but-for test is a test commonly used in both tort law and criminal law to determine actual causation. The test asks, "but for the existence of P, would Q have occurred?" If the answer is yes, then factor P is an actual cause of result Q.
